Spring Daddy (1985)

Taiwanese kitchen-sink realismworking-class tragedybittersweet satire

Overview

Drama

Zang Guang-xing is a veteran soldier from Mainland China who married a young Taiwanese woman. He has been working as a supervisor in a construction company for seven years. Everyday he rides the same motorbike to work. He suffers enough misery from riding that motorbike, and dreams of buying a car. So he asks around for decent second-hand cars. His son doesn't like any car he chooses. His wife, a typical Taiwanese woman who lives frugally, shaves any penny she can. She is the one who pays for the family's new car. They go out on trips happily, and become the envy of the neighborhood. Zhang thus gets the new car he's always dreamed of, but he starts to worry about it getting dirty, because it's simply too new, too nice for him. The car thus becomes his son's vehicle. He rides the old bike to work again, just like he has during all these years.

Cultural

Made during Taiwan's explosive economic boom, the film interrogates the 'Mainland husband/Taiwanese wife' dynamic common in post-1949 migration.

Insight

Wang Tung reportedly based the motorbike on his own father's vehicle, which he rode for 20 years. The car in the film was brand new—a production luxury that ironically made the actors uncomfortable.
